Types of Waste Generated

Residential Waste

Residential areas in West London contribute significantly to the overall waste stream. Common household waste includes organic waste like food scraps, recyclable materials such as paper, plastics, glass, and metals, as well as non-recyclable items like certain plastics and textiles. Effective separation and disposal of these waste types are essential for minimizing environmental impact.

Many households in West London participate in recycling programs, separating their waste into different categories to facilitate easier processing. This not only helps in reducing the volume of waste sent to landfills but also promotes the reuse of materials, conserving natural resources and reducing the carbon footprint.

In addition to regular waste, households often generate bulky waste items such as furniture and appliances. Proper disposal of these items requires specialized services to ensure they are handled responsibly, either through recycling or safe disposal methods.

Waste Collection Services

Scheduled Pick-Up

West London boasts a comprehensive waste collection system, providing regular pick-up services for both residential and commercial clients. Scheduled pick-ups ensure that waste is collected efficiently, preventing accumulation and reducing the risk of environmental contamination.

The local councils coordinate these services, offering various collection frequencies based on the type of waste and the area served. Specialized collection services are also available for hazardous waste, electronic waste, and other specific categories, ensuring safe and compliant disposal practices.

To enhance convenience, many waste collection services in West London offer online scheduling and notifications, allowing residents and businesses to manage their waste disposal more effectively. These digital tools help in optimizing collection routes, reducing operational costs, and minimizing disruptions to the community.

Recycling Facilities and Initiatives

Local Recycling Centers

West London is home to several recycling centers equipped to handle various types of recyclable materials. These centers play a pivotal role in diverting waste from landfills, promoting the circular economy by facilitating the reuse and recycling of valuable resources.

Residents and businesses can bring their recyclable items to these centers, where materials like paper, plastics, metals, and glass are sorted and processed. Advanced technologies at these facilities ensure that recyclable materials are efficiently transformed into new products, reducing the need for virgin materials and conserving energy.

In addition to traditional recycling centers, West London has adopted innovative recycling initiatives such as community recycling programs, which encourage local participation in waste reduction efforts. These initiatives often include educational campaigns, incentives for recycling, and partnerships with local businesses to promote sustainable practices.

Waste Disposal Regulations and Policies

Local Government Policies

The waste disposal landscape in West London is governed by a set of comprehensive regulations and policies aimed at minimizing environmental impact and promoting sustainable waste management practices. Local government bodies enforce these regulations, ensuring compliance among residents and businesses alike.

Policies include waste reduction targets, mandatory recycling requirements, and restrictions on the disposal of hazardous materials. These regulations are designed to encourage responsible waste management, reduce dependence on landfills, and promote the use of eco-friendly alternatives.

Additionally, the local government collaborates with environmental agencies and organizations to monitor waste management practices, providing support and resources to improve waste disposal systems. Regular assessments and updates to policies ensure that waste management strategies remain effective and aligned with evolving environmental standards.

Challenges in Waste Management

Increasing Waste Volume

One of the significant challenges faced by West London is the ever-increasing volume of waste generated. Population growth, urbanization, and economic activities contribute to the surge in waste production, straining existing waste management systems.

Managing this growing waste requires continuous investment in waste collection infrastructure, recycling facilities, and disposal technologies. Additionally, it necessitates the implementation of strategies aimed at waste reduction and efficient resource utilization to keep up with the rising demand.

Public Participation

Effective waste management heavily relies on the active participation of the public. Encouraging residents and businesses to adopt sustainable waste disposal practices is crucial for the success of waste management programs.

Challenges such as lack of awareness, improper waste segregation, and inconsistent participation can hinder waste management efforts. Addressing these issues through education, incentives, and community engagement initiatives is essential to foster a culture of responsible waste disposal.
